The brief.

Vladimir Mortev writes Bulgarian literary fiction with a strong cyberpunk sensibility — dense worldbuilding, dark urban atmosphere, prose that rewards close reading. He needed a web presence that could introduce him to new readers, showcase his bibliography, and feel like an extension of the world his fiction inhabits.

The brief was short: make something that feels like the books. Not a standard author portfolio with a headshot and a book grid. Something with the atmosphere of a Mortev novel — where the design itself signals what kind of writer this is before a single word is read.

Constraints

  • Atmospheric, not decorative — the dark aesthetics had to serve the brand, not distract from it. The writing remains the point.
  • Self-manageable — the author updates his own content; the CMS needed to be simple enough to use without training.
  • Bibliography-first — books are the primary content; the structure had to make the back catalogue easy to discover.
  • Multilingual potential — Bulgarian primary, with the architecture to add English pages for international publishers.

Our approach.

We started with atmosphere. The visual system uses a dark base, high-contrast typography, and carefully chosen accent colours drawn from the book covers — neon greens, electric blues, deep reds. The result is a site that immediately communicates genre and sensibility without explaining either.

The bibliography is structured as individual book pages with synopses, excerpt previews, and purchase links. Each book has a distinct visual treatment — the cover art dominates, and the surrounding design adapts to it rather than imposing a uniform template across all titles.

The stack.

  • WordPress with custom post types for books, news, and events — simple enough for the author to manage alone
  • Custom design — fully bespoke visual system; no starter theme, no generic components
  • Cover-adaptive layouts — book page templates that adapt their visual treatment to the cover art rather than imposing a single fixed template
